Codex CLI Skill
⚠️ Environment Notice
| Environment | Git Repo | Command Format |
|---|---|---|
| Interactive terminal | Any | codex "prompt" |
| Claude Code / CI | ✅ Yes | codex exec -s read-only "prompt" |
| Claude Code / CI | ❌ No | codex exec --skip-git-repo-check -s read-only "prompt" |
Non-TTY environments (Claude Code, CI pipelines, scripts) require codex exec.
Git Repository Detection
Before executing Codex commands, check if the working directory is a Git repository:
bash
# Check Git repository status git rev-parse --git-dir 2>/dev/null && echo "Git repo: YES" || echo "Git repo: NO"
- •Git repo exists: Use standard commands
- •No Git repo: Add
--skip-git-repo-checkflag (requires user awareness of security implications)

Session Resume (Special Syntax)
bash
# IMPORTANT: Options must come BEFORE 'resume' subcommand # SESSION_ID is from previous command output (e.g., 019ae3a3-f1cf-7dc1-8eee-8f424ae7a6f0) # In Git repository codex exec -s read-only resume [SESSION_ID] "Continue the analysis" # Outside Git repository codex exec --skip-git-repo-check -s read-only resume [SESSION_ID] "Continue the analysis"

Sandbox Modes
| Mode | Description |
|---|---|
read-only | Cannot modify files (safest, recommended) |
workspace-write | Can modify workspace files |
danger-full-access | Full system access (use sparingly) |

Platform-Specific Notes
Windows Limitations
| Issue | Description | Workaround |
|---|---|---|
-C with absolute paths | cwd is not absolute error with Windows paths like C:\path | Use relative paths (./subdir) or run from target directory |
| Path separators | Backslashes may cause issues | Use forward slashes (/) in paths |
bash
# AVOID on Windows: codex exec -C C:\Projects\myapp -s read-only "analyze" # USE instead: cd C:\Projects\myapp && codex exec -s read-only "analyze" # OR use relative paths: codex exec -C ./myapp -s read-only "analyze"
Error Handling
Error recovery patterns: See Examples
| Error | Cause | Solution |
|---|---|---|
stdin is not a terminal | Using codex in non-TTY | Use codex exec |
Not inside a trusted directory | Not in Git repo | Ask user, then use --skip-git-repo-check |
invalid value for '--ask-for-approval' | Invalid approval value | Use: untrusted, on-failure, on-request, never |
unexpected argument after resume | Options after resume | Place options BEFORE resume subcommand |
cwd is not absolute | Windows absolute path | Use relative paths or cd first |
No prompt provided via stdin | Empty prompt | Ensure prompt string is not empty |
Timeout Configuration
| Task Type | Recommended Timeout | Claude Code Tool |
|---|---|---|
| Quick checks | 2 minutes | timeout: 120000 |
| Standard review | 5 minutes | timeout: 300000 |
| Deep analysis | 10 minutes | timeout: 600000 |
Recommendation: Use timeout: 600000 for all Codex exec commands (model_reasoning_effort=high/xhigh can take 3-7 minutes).
